Prayer Cards: A Thoughtful Gesture
Alongside programs, many families opt for prayer cards. These small cards can feature a comforting prayer, a photo, or a meaningful quote. They serve as a beautiful memento for attendees to take home, helping to keep the memory of the loved one alive.
Creating a Personal Touch
Personalization is a vital aspect of funeral planning. Families can incorporate unique elements into the service, such as favorite songs, themed decorations, or even a video montage showcasing memorable moments. It’s about celebrating a life lived and ensuring that the service feels authentic.
